BT56 AUR is a 2006 Lexus IS220 in Black with a 2,231c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2006 Lexus IS220 models, the average MOT pass rate is 80.2% with a typical mileage of 93,392 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Lexus IS220 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 5,421 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BT56 AUR,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Lexus IS220 typically stays on UK roads for around 20 years. At 20 years old, this Lexus IS220 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
